
Blustin Design
Identity and stationery for an architecture and interior practice based
in East London. The identity is inspired by architectural hatch patterns
which are used to distinguish different building materials while using
mono colour printing. As most of the identity will be printed in-house on
their studio printer it was important that the identity was economical
and can be reproduced easily within these printing constraints.
As the client is in control of the printing, changing the paper stock often
is encouraged.
